Setting the Stage: Bet, Speed, and the Countdown
Before you launch into action, you face two critical choices: your stake and your speed setting. The minimum bet is a tiny €0.10, while the maximum stretches to €1,000 – but most short‑session players stick to a modest range so they can keep playing many rounds.
Speed determines how fast the aircraft travels along its path; four levels are available – from “Slow” (low risk) to “Turbo” (high risk). In short sessions, most users gravitate toward “Fast” or “Turbo” because they want to hit big multipliers quickly.
- Fast speed: Balanced risk; moderate multiplier potential.
- Turbo speed: Highest risk; chance for the biggest jumps.
- Normal speed: Default; a safe middle ground.
- Slow speed: Rarely used in quick bursts due to low payoff.

The High‑Speed Thrill: Multipliers & Rockets in Action
While the aircraft soars, it encounters an array of multipliers that pile on your winnings: +1, +2, +5, +10, and even x2, x3, x4, x5 symbols appear randomly along the flight path. Each new multiplier nudges your potential payout higher.
A twist that keeps players on their toes are rockets – sudden flashes that slash your counter balance by half and lower altitude. Rockets add a layer of tension; you can’t predict when they’ll spawn, so every round feels fresh.
- Multiplier types:
- +1, +2, +5 (small boosts)
- x2–x5 (larger jumps)
- Rocket effect: halves accumulated winnings and reduces flight height.

Landing in a Blink: All‑or‑Nothing Decision
The climax of every round is the landing phase – a single instant where your aircraft either hits the ship deck or splashes into water. The moment is all‑or‑nothing; if you hit the carrier, the counter balance is multiplied by whatever multiplier you’ve collected; if you miss, everything is lost.
- Win celebration: A bright pop‑up window pops up when you land successfully.
- Mega wins: Multipliers like x20 or x40 trigger big celebrations.

Managing the Short Sprint: Bankroll Rules for Intense Rounds
Because short sessions involve rapid betting, bankroll management becomes crucial. A simple rule many players follow is the “5% rule”: never bet more than 5% of your total bankroll per round.
- Example: With €200 bankroll, max bet per round = €10.
- Sustainability: Allows dozens of rounds before reaching loss limit.
This approach keeps risk in check while still enabling quick wins that match the high‑intensity vibe.
- If you lose twice in a row: Stick with your current speed; don’t chase losses by increasing bet size.
- If you win: Consider adding an extra 1–2 rounds at the same stake instead of scaling up immediately.
- If you hit a big win: Take out 20% of that profit as profit before returning to normal betting.
